About the Role
Mid-Level .NET Core Developer – Banking Solutions
Lodz
Hybrid
.NET 8
.NET Core
C#
Docker
Entity Framework
Kubernetes
SQL
Web APIs
Polish
Mid-Level
Banking
Developer
Unleash innovation — shape the future of banking technology!
Łódź-based opportunity with hybrid work model (2 days in the office per month).
As a Mid-Level .NET Core Developer – Banking Solutions, you will be working for our client, a leading player in the online banking sector. You will contribute to the development and enhancement of core banking systems, enabling innovative financial services and digital transformation. This is a chance to grow your career within a dynamic environment focused on cutting-edge technology solutions.
Your main responsibilities:
Implement backend solutions using C#, .NET Core, and .NET 8
Develop and maintain automated unit and integration tests
Design and execute software development and deployment projects
Maintain systems ensuring seamless communication with internal and external platforms
Collaborate with cross-functional teams to deliver integrated solutions
Work with new technologies to enhance system performance and capabilities
Manage databases using SQL, Entity Framework, and Web APIs
Participate in Agile development cycles, writing high-quality documentation
Support deployment and ongoing maintenance of systems in production environments
You're ideal for this role if you have:
Minimum of 3 years of experience in software development, specifically with C# and .NET 8
Strong knowledge of MS SQL and experience with Docker and Kubernetes
Hands-on experience with unit testing and automated test development
Familiarity with user requirements analysis and system design methodologies
Experience working within Agile teams
Strong communication skills and ability to work collaboratively
It is a strong plus if you have: (optional)
Experience with tools like TeamCity, PowerShell, DevOps, SonarQube
Knowledge of AI-powered solutions (e.g., LLM APIs such as OpenAI or Azure OpenAI, chatbots, text processing)
Familiarity with cloud solutions
Language Required for the role:
Polish (Communicative level)
Eligibility for the role:
Only candidates with an existing legal right to work in the European Union will be considered for this role.
Tech Stack
.NET Core.NET 8C#DockerKubernetesSQLEntity FrameworkWeb APIsUnit Testing